We've picked up almost 6 feet of snow in the past 7 days! It began snowing heavily Sunday and it hasn't let up since. High winds kept upper mountain closed on Monday but it was an epic powder feast on Tuesday with the best conditions many of us have ever skied. It was deep, light and bottomless. Upper mountain was open along with High Campbell and short-Northway even opened towards the end of the day. Smiles were large, high fives were in abundance and the words "best day ever" were heard as skiers and boarders gathered at the end of the day. We woke up to more new snow Wednesday but the winds were gusting into the high 60's forcing us to close upper mountain. |
